Key Ingredients of Praline Party Mix
The secret to a good prаline partу mіx is using a mix of nuts , grains and swееt glaze that balance each other out . Here’s what you need :
Nuts are a star here . Pecans , almonds or peanuts all work and add a rich , crunchy bite . They also bring protein and good fats so it’s not just empty calories .
Grains and cereals like Chex or Rice squares give you a light crispiness . Whole grains add fiber too , which helps fill you up so you don’t just keep eating one handful after another .
Praline sugar coating is what makes this mix stand out . You melt butter with brown sugar and a bit of syrup (maple or corn) , then pour it over the snacks . It hardens into a sweet , buttery glaze . You can even swap honey or agave if you want a different flavor or less refined sugar .

Detailed Praline Party Mix Recipe
Ingredients
- 2 cups of mixed nuts (pecans , almonds , walnuts)
- 3 cups of pretzel sticks
- 4 cups of Corn or Rice cereal
- 1 cup of popcorn (popped , unsalted)
- 1 cup of unsweetened coconut flakes (optional)
- 1 cup of brown sugar
- 1 cup of butter (unsalted)
- 1 cup of maple syrup (or corn syrup)
- 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ract
- A pinch of salt and cinnamon (optional)
Directions
- Preparation: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) . Line baking sheets with parchment paper .
- Mix dry bits: In a large bоwl , stir together nuts , pretzels , cereals and popcorn .
- Make praline sauce: In a saucepan over medium heat melt butter . Add brown sugar , syrup , vanilla and salt , then bring to a boil . Let it bubble for 2–3 minutes until it’s a bit thicker .
- Combine: Pour the hot praline sauce over dry іngredients and stir until all pieces are coated .
- Bake: Spread the coated mix on the prepared sheets . Bake for 10–12 minutes until golden brown , stirring once halfway .
- Cool: Take trays out and let the mix cool completely so it crisps up .
- Store: Keep in an airtight container for up to two weeks , if it lasts that long .
Tips and Advice
You can swap nuts for seeds if someone’s allergic or use gluten-free pretzels to fit special diets . To lighten it up , try less sugar or switch to natural sweeteners like honey . Feel free to toss in spices like nutmeg or a pinch of cayenne for a kick .

Praline Party Mix Variations
Sweet Variants
To make it sweeter , stir in chocolate chips , M&M’s or candy pieces after baking . You can even mix in flavored popcorn like caramel or strawberry for a fun twist .
Savory Variants
If you want more savory , add spice blends , dried herbs or cheese-flavored snacks . Roasted chickpeas or spicy nuts bring a bold taste that balances the sweetness nicely .
Frequently Asked Questions
What is the origin of praline?
Praline started in France as sugar-coated nuts . Over time it traveled to other places and got turned into many versions , including this party mix with its sweet coating .
Can I make praline party mix ahead of time?
Yes , you can make it a few days before your event . Just store it in an airtight container and it’ll stay fresh and crunchy .
How long does praline party mix last?
Stored right , it lasts about two weeks . But most likely it’ll be eaten long before that .
What are some variations I can try?
Try different nuts , cereals or add-ins like chocolate pieces , dried fruit or flavored popcorn to create your own signature mix .
Can I freeze my praline party mix?
Yes , you can freeze it in a sealed bag or container . Thaw at room temp when you’re ready to snack .

Praline Party Mix Recipe
Equipment
- 1 large mixing bowl
- 1 baking sheet
- 1 parchment paper
- 1 saucepan
- 1 rubber spatula
- 1 wooden spoon
- 1 set measuring cups
- 1 set measuring spoons
Ingredients
- 2 cups pecan halves
- 2 cups almonds
- 2 cups mini pretzels
- 2 cups Rice Chex cereal
- 1 cup unsalted butter 2 sticks
- 2 cups brown sugar
- ½ cup corn syrup
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¼ te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the pecans, almonds, pretzels, and Rice Chex cereal. Stir to mix evenly.
- In a saucepan, melt the unsalted butter over medium heat.
- Add the brown sugar and corn syrup to the melted butter, stirring constantly until the mixture comes to a boil. Allow it to boil for 2 minutes without stirring.
- Remove the saucepan from heat and stir in the vanilla extract, baking soda, and salt. The mixture will bubble up.
- Pour the butter mixture over the dry ingredients in the large bowl. Using a rubber spatula, gently fold the mixture together until everything is well coated.
- Spread the coated mix evenly on the prepared baking sheet.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, stirring every 10 minutes to ensure even baking.
- Remove from the oven and allow to cool completely on the baking sheet.
- Once cooled, break the mix into clusters and store in an airtight container until ready to serve.
